A theoretical model for bending and ex-tension of composite beams of open t
hin-walled geometry is devised. The model is based an a detailed descriptio
n of the out-of-plane warping and may handle generic open cross-sectional g
eometries and arbitrary layup configurations. in view, of the potential of
composite beams to produce useful structural couplings, the analysis is foc
used on the ability to predict the coupling mechanisms, and draw lines of s
imilarities and differences between such beams and similar thin-walled beam
s of closed cross sections.
